What counts as an unusual wedding venue?

“Unusual” means something different to every couple - and that’s the point. It can be quirky, cool, unexpected or completely one-of-a-kind. What ties these venues together is that they break away from tradition and offer something more personal, more memorable, and often more flexible.

Across the UK, unusual wedding venues typically fall into a few key categories:

Repurposed and industrial spaces

Think converted warehouses, old mills, breweries, libraries and even former churches. These spaces often combine raw character with creative freedom, making them popular for quirky wedding venues UK searches and design-led couples.

Cultural and heritage venues

Museums, theatres, cinemas and galleries offer built-in atmosphere and incredible photo opportunities. Many of the most unique wedding reception venues fall into this category, especially in cities like London and Manchester.

Natural and outdoor settings

Woodland clearings, beaches, vineyards and cliffside locations offer a completely different kind of experience. These are ideal if you’re looking for unusual places to get married UK-wide, particularly for smaller or more relaxed celebrations.

Architectural standouts

From castles with a twist to lighthouses, windmills, follies and even treehouses - these venues deliver serious visual impact and are often what people mean when they search for strange wedding venues UK or something truly different.

Intimate and boutique spaces

Private members’ clubs, stylish restaurants and townhouse venues are perfect for small unusual wedding venues UK couples. They’re often more flexible and feel more personal than larger traditional venues.

Unusual venues can offer incredible experiences, but they also come with a few extra considerations. Here’s what to keep in mind:

Ceremony licence

Not all unusual venues are licensed for civil ceremonies. Always check whether you can legally marry on-site or if you’ll need a separate ceremony location.

Capacity and layout

Some of the most unique venues are smaller or have unconventional layouts. Make sure the space works for both your ceremony and reception plans.

Logistics

From parking to power supply, unusual venues sometimes require more planning. This is especially true for outdoor or blank-canvas spaces.

Supplier flexibility

Many unusual venues allow external caterers and suppliers - a huge plus for creative couples - but always confirm what’s included.

Consistency of space

A stunning entrance doesn’t always mean the whole venue matches. Make sure the atmosphere carries through from ceremony to reception.

How much do unusual wedding venues cost?

Pricing varies widely depending on the type of venue and location, but typical UK ranges include:

  • Converted or industrial spaces: £3,000–£10,000
  • Museums and heritage venues: £5,000–£20,000+
  • Outdoor or natural settings: £2,000–£10,000 (plus infrastructure)
  • Boutique or small venues: from £2,000
  • Rural or alternative estates: £4,000–£15,000

While some unique wedding locations UK-wide can be premium, others offer excellent value compared to traditional venues - especially if you’re flexible on date or location.

What counts as an unusual wedding venue?

An unusual wedding venue is any setting that breaks away from traditional options like hotels or manor houses. This could include industrial spaces, museums, outdoor locations, or architecturally unique buildings.

Do unusual wedding venues have ceremony licences?

Some do, but not all. Always check whether the venue is licensed for civil ceremonies or if you’ll need to hold the legal ceremony elsewhere.

Are unusual wedding venues more expensive?

Not necessarily. Some can be more expensive due to exclusivity or location (especially in London), but others offer great value - particularly blank-canvas or off-peak options.
